How Many Coffee Beans Per Cup French Press: The Perfect Ratio for a Perfect Brew

Coffee lovers around the world have different preferences when it comes to brewing their favorite beverage. One popular method is the French press, which offers a rich and full-bodied cup of coffee. However, determining the right amount of coffee beans per cup for a French press can be a bit of a mystery for many. In this article, we will explore the ideal ratio of coffee beans to water for a perfect French press cup of coffee.

The Importance of the Right Ratio

The ratio of coffee beans to water is crucial in achieving the perfect French press cup of coffee. Too many beans and the coffee may become too strong and bitter, while too few beans can result in a weak and underdeveloped flavor. The general rule of thumb is to use one to two tablespoons of coffee beans per six ounces of water. However, this can vary depending on your personal taste preferences and the type of coffee you are using.

Factors to Consider

Several factors can influence the amount of coffee beans you should use per cup in a French press. Here are some key considerations:

1. Coffee Bean Type: Different coffee beans have varying levels of acidity, body, and flavor. For example, darker roasts tend to be more robust and require a slightly higher ratio of beans to water, while lighter roasts may need a lower ratio.

2. Coffee Grind Size: The grind size of your coffee beans also plays a role in the brewing process. A finer grind will extract more flavor, while a coarser grind will result in a milder cup. Adjust the ratio accordingly based on your desired taste.

3. Personal Preference: Ultimately, the perfect ratio is subjective and depends on your personal taste preferences. Experiment with different ratios to find the one that suits your taste buds best.

Calculating the Right Amount

To calculate the right amount of coffee beans for your French press, follow these simple steps:

1. Determine the desired number of cups: Decide how many cups of coffee you want to brew. For example, if you want two cups, you will need 12 to 24 ounces of water.

2. Choose your coffee beans: Select the type of coffee beans you prefer, keeping in mind the factors mentioned earlier.

3. Measure the coffee beans: Use a kitchen scale to measure the coffee beans. One tablespoon of coffee beans is approximately 7 grams. For two cups, you would need 14 to 28 grams of coffee beans.

4. Adjust the ratio: If you find that the coffee is too strong or too weak, adjust the ratio of coffee beans to water accordingly.
